Q: Is 102,232,311 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 102,232,311 is a composite number.

Why is 102,232,311 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 102,232,311 can be evenly divided by 1 3 41 123 271 813 3,067 9,201 11,111 33,333 125,747 377,241 831,157 2,493,471 34,077,437 and 102,232,311, with no remainder.

Since 102,232,311 cannot be divided by just 1 and 102,232,311, it is a composite number.
